Internal Memo — Second-Source Supplier Search

Finance folks: heads up that Quillbrook Manufacturing is formally scouting a second source for the Averline gearbox housings. Tornvale Castings remains our primary, but lead times have crept past nine weeks. We're evaluating three candidates in the Meldrath region; sample tooling costs land in next month's accruals. Keep this off supplier calls for now. The confidential rationale follows below.

internal memo for taguf-kafop: Novmirax Group plans to lower the Oliius list price by 42.0 percent in March. The board signed off on a budget of $367.8 million for Project Belael. The renewal with Drumirax Logistics closes at $302.4 million a year, 54.0 percent below the last contract. Project Kelys slips by a full year because of the staffing delay.

# Farecalc Environments

Farecalc is the rules engine that computes shipping fees for the Dunmoor storefronts. Three environments: sandbox, staging, prod. Sandbox rebuilds nightly from synthetic orders; staging mirrors prod rules with a 24h lag; prod is release-gated and deploys only via the Lanternway pipeline. Rule changes must bake in staging for one full business day. Releases to prod require release-manager approval and a passing fee-parity check. Each environment carries its own settings; the production set is below.

config for hahip-kaguf:
[holath]
port = 8443
region = north-4
host = holath.tolvaqlabs.internal
timeout_ms = 1000
retries = 2

Ticket: config drift — Wrenfold waveform preview

Staging and prod have diverged on the waveform preview service. Prod renders at 200 samples/px, staging at 120; peak-normalization flags also differ. Causes mismatched previews in QA signoff. Blocking Friday's release until reconciled. Current prod values for reference follow.

settings of fafog-haduf:
ZORIX_PIN=4648
ZORIX_METRICS_HOST=metrics.zorix.paliqsys.corp
ZORIX_LOG_LEVEL=info
ZORIX_TENANT=druix

TICKET: Query planner regression in Mirelle DB after the v9 rollout. Plans that used index scans now fall back to full scans on the reporting cluster only — the planner cost knobs drifted from the baseline during an emergency hotfix in March and were never reverted. Future maintainers: do not tune these by hand again; use the managed profile. The drifted cluster currently reports the following settings.

deployment values, bajop-yahaf:
[holax]
host = holax.tolvaqsys.corp
user = holax_svc
database = holax_prod